Which block should I choose for a sound-insulated partition?

For sound insulation choose larger, denser blocks such as KERATERM 44 or 51, since greater mass improves sound reduction. Also use appropriate masonry mortars and plaster designed for acoustic performance.

Can VITRA glass blocks be used for bathroom partitions?

Yes, VITRA and PEGASUS glass blocks are suitable for wet rooms and are commonly used in bathrooms and shower partitions due to their moisture resistance and decorative look. Ensure you select a model and installation method suited for vertical, wet-area use.
